Gantz: In next war, army will powerfully enter depths of enemy territory

Defense Minister Benny Gantz stressed that in the next operation or war, Israeli forces will "immediately and powerfully" enter the depths of enemy territory, if need be, during a memorial ceremony for soldiers who fell during the Second Lebanon War.
"In the next operations or, God forbid, wars, when we have to reach the depths of the enemy again, these forces, which are based on both regular and reserve [forces] - will arrive immediately and powerfully, and will be a central part of the fighting," said Gantz.
"We will activate them if required. Not lightly, but with the knowledge and understanding that the decisive capacity of the army is required, powerful, existing and ready for the tasks before us," added Gantz.
Gantz stressed that while Israel wishes for peace, it is willing to use its "full capacity" in any arena, including Lebanon.
"Attempts to quietly sabotage our borders do not go unnoticed, and we keep our eyes open, act routinely and are prepared for extensive operations even in emergencies," said Gantz.
